Pakistan’s recent announcement regarding the establishment of the Pakistan Crypto Council (PCC) is nothing short of a monumental shift in the nation’s financial narrative. This move indicates a significant departure from the previous skepticism that surrounded digital assets, especially in light of national security concerns and terrorism financing. Once viewed as pariahs in the financial world, cryptocurrencies are now being recognized for their transformative potential. The PCC aims to not only regulate but also embrace and integrate blockchain technology into Pakistan’s economy, thus positioning the country as a forward-thinking player in the global arena of digital finance.

Leadership that Inspires Confidence

With Finance Minister Muhammad Aurangzeb at the helm and a diverse board comprising experts from key financial institutions, the PCC is structured to tackle the multifaceted challenges posed by cryptocurrencies. The appointment of Bilal bin Saqib as Chief Advisor is particularly noteworthy, as it symbolizes the government’s commitment to innovation and modernization. This leadership promises a balanced approach, blending regulatory oversight with an innate understanding of the tech landscape. Such a framework is essential for ensuring that Pakistan well navigates this uncharted territory while maximizing the potential benefits of digital currencies.

Tapping into Untapped Markets

Current estimates suggest that Pakistan boasts around 20 million active crypto users, contributing to approximately $20 billion in transactions annually. This statistic unveils a vast pool of untapped financial potential that, if harnessed correctly, could propel the economy to new heights. Furthermore, Pakistan’s robust remittance market, valued at an impressive $35 billion, stands to gain immensely from the facilitation of cryptocurrency transactions. This progress could serve to enhance financial security for millions, fortifying the economic backbone of the country.
